Marie-Louise Michel is a scholar working on Immunology, Epidemiology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Marie-Louise Michel has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 661 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Immunology, 7 papers in Epidemiology and 4 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Marie-Louise Michel’s work include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(7 papers), Hepatitis B Virus Studies (7 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(3 papers). Marie-Louise Michel is often cited by papers focused on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(7 papers), Hepatitis B Virus Studies (7 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(3 papers). Marie-Louise Michel collaborates with scholars based in France, Germany and Canada. Marie-Louise Michel's co-authors include Heather L. Davis, Robert G. Whalen, Miguel Martín, Florian Martin, Anne Caignard, Pierre Tiollais, M Mancini, Yves Rivière, Sylvie Le Borgne and Roger Le Grand and has published in prestigious journals such as Gastroenterology, Gut and Annals of the New York Academy of Sciences.
